Of course, situations constantly arise in our life where it is convenient to use cash, and sometimes it is just the only available form of payment. Of course, the percentage of use of cash depends largely on whether you live in a megacity or in a rural area, on the standard of living in a particular state, the nature of your activity and many other factors.
Payment by non-cash money binds us to certain technical means and their normal use also depends on a number of reasons, and which can always fail.
Cash does not have these disadvantages.
